How can I run System Restore when the shortcut to this is missing?

I need to roll back to a previous Restore Point, but ironically the problem I am trying to fix is that I have lost all my Program Shortcuts. (So I can't launch System Restore.)

I am using Windows XP Home.

Click on your Start Button. Select Run. Type "msconfig". Press Ok.
When the System Configuration window opens press the Launch System Restore Button.
